The rise of the FLV format solved a massive problem for the early internet: fragmented media playback. In the early 2000s, watching a video online required heavy standalone media players like Windows Media Player, QuickTime, or RealPlayer. Codec mismatches routinely broke playback for everyday users.

In the age of 4K streaming and adaptive bitrate codecs, the acronym (Flash Video) might feel like a relic from a dial-up past. However, to dismiss the FLV format is to ignore the very foundation of online democratized video. From 2002 until the mid-2010s, the .flv file extension was the undisputed king of the internet.

Why did FLV die? Mobile devices. The iPhone (2007) famously did not support Flash. As the world moved to HTML5 and the <video> tag, h.264 (MP4) took over.
